HIS PATH TO PASTORAL MINISTRY

Travis is a Colorado native. He joined the Navy in 1988, where God regenerated him to new life and faith in Christ. Thankful to God for 27 years of marriage, Travis and his wife Melinda have five children: Nic, Leah, Jesse, Scott, and Cali. 

After a stint in law enforcement, Travis pursued ministry training (The College at Southeastern for a B.A. in 1997 and The Master’s Seminary for a M.Div. in 2006).

In 2014, he accepted the teaching pastor position at Grace Church in Greeley and returned to Colorado.

Path to Ministry

Josh was raised in Greeley Colorado and grew up attending Grace Church. He came to faith in Jesus Christ in 1997. He was involved in youth and college ministry while attending the University of Northern Colorado where he received his B.A. in 2003. After graduating he spent two years doing campus ministry at the University of Oregon.

Josh married his wonderful wife Diana in 2005 and she has been a tremendous blessing and his greatest asset in ministry ever since. God has blessed them with five precious children: Lana, Nathan, Ava, Ella, and Caiden.
